This three minute video reviews how an animated video is made for Brainpop. The same ideas can be used to make such videos for other sources and reasons as well. The steps include: First the audio is recorded. Next, the animator sketches a comic stri...p for the video called a storyboard. Animated videos are usually made with digital animation. Digital animations use computers to create moving
images. Different images are put together in sequence to give the impression that the figures are moving. Most 2-d animated videos are made with flash. After the animation files are done, the audio is synchronized to the animation creating the video. The video moves rapidly so the teacher may need to stop and provide more indepth knowledge during certain sequences.

Painting with light is an important part of your movie. Lighting can effect the mood of your final product. Have a shot list so you know how to set up your lighting. You do not need professional lighting, there are household lamps that will work.
